技术文摘
谈谈 Harbor 架构的相关事宜
谈谈 Harbor 架构的相关事宜
在当今数字化的时代,容器技术的应用愈发广泛,而 Harbor 作为一款优秀的容器镜像仓库,其架构具有重要的研究价值。
Harbor 架构的核心组件包括了多个关键部分。首先是核心服务,它负责处理用户的请求、管理镜像仓库的操作以及与其他组件进行通信。再者是数据库,用于存储用户信息、镜像元数据等重要数据,确保数据的一致性和可靠性。
Harbor 的存储系统也是架构中的关键一环。它支持多种存储后端,如本地文件系统、对象存储等,以满足不同规模和性能需求的场景。这种灵活性使得企业可以根据自身的实际情况选择最适合的存储方案,从而优化存储成本和性能。
在安全性方面,Harbor 架构提供了多层防护。用户认证和授权机制确保只有合法用户能够进行相应的操作。镜像签名和扫描功能能够检测潜在的安全漏洞,保障镜像的安全性和可信度。
Harbor 还具备良好的扩展性。通过插件机制,可以轻松集成第三方的认证系统、存储后端或者其他功能模块,以适应不断变化的业务需求和技术环境。
对于大规模的部署场景,Harbor 架构支持高可用和集群部署。通过多个节点的协同工作,可以提高系统的整体性能和可靠性,确保在高并发的情况下依然能够稳定运行。
Harbor 与其他容器技术生态系统的集成也非常出色。它能够与 Kubernetes 等容器编排平台无缝对接,为容器化应用的部署和管理提供了便捷的支持。
Harbor 架构以其强大的功能、出色的安全性、良好的扩展性和与生态系统的紧密集成,成为了容器镜像管理领域的重要解决方案。深入理解和掌握 Harbor 架构,对于企业有效地管理和利用容器技术,推动数字化转型具有重要的意义。无论是小型团队还是大型企业,都可以从 Harbor 架构的优势中受益,实现更高效、更安全的容器化应用开发和部署。
- Ubuntu 22.04.2 LTS 维护版本更新 已升至 Linux 5.19
- Fedora 23 安装默认拼音输入法的步骤
- Mac 废纸篓无法清空的解决办法及清空教程
- Linux5.19 内核大幅提升!Ubuntu 22.04 LTS 能升级至该版本
- Debian11 中 thunar 文件管理器的位置及打开技巧
- elementary OS 7 基于 Ubuntu 发布 附官方下载
- Debian11 默认终端模拟器的设置步骤
- Debian 系统注销方法及 Debian11 关闭系统的技巧
- 苹果 Macbook 强制退出程序的办法
- Debian 及 Debian11 Mate 锁定屏幕的技巧
- 苹果 Mac 屏幕共享的设置方法与图文教程
- 苹果 OS X 10.11.4 El Capitan Beta1 发布 以完善性能为重
- Mac OS X 系统中 iTunes 目录的搬家办法
- 安卓设备与 Mac 连接的三种简便方式
- OS X 系统下让苹果电脑(Mac/MacBook)快速锁屏/息屏的方法